Donald Sidney-Fryer

Donald Sidney-Fryer (born September 8, 1934, in New Bedford, Massachusetts) is an American poet, critic, literary historian, ballet historian, and performer in the tradition of California Romantics, influenced by mentors Edmund Spenser and Clark Ashton Smith. He specializes in medieval romance and epic poetry, continuing the line from Ambrose Bierce, George Sterling, and Clark Ashton Smith. In 2018, he self-published a massive history of Romantic Ballet and biography of composer Cesare Pugni.
